Audi Q8 Engine Mount Replacement Cost

Between $575 and $658

The average cost for an Audi Q8 Engine Mount Replacement is between $575 and $658. The average cost for an Audi Q8 Engine Mount Replacement is between $575 and $658. Labor costs are estimated between $317 and $400 while parts are typically priced around $258.
This range does not include taxes and fees, and does not factor in your unique location. Related repairs may also be needed.

The cost of automotive repairs, including engine mount replacements, can vary significantly depending on your geographic location. Major metropolitan areas with a higher cost of living often see higher labor rates. Conversely, rural areas may offer more competitive pricing. For example, an Audi Q8 engine mount replacement in a high-cost city like San Francisco or New York could lean towards the higher end of the estimated range, while a similar repair in a smaller town might be closer to the lower end.

When it comes to engine mounts, the quality of the part significantly impacts both the repair cost and the long-term performance.

  • O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) Parts: These are parts manufactured by or for Audi. They are designed to meet the exact specifications of your Q8, ensuring optimal fit, performance, and durability. OEM engine mounts are generally more expensive, typically ranging from $250 to $400 or more per mount.
  • Aftermarket Parts: These parts are made by companies other than Audi. While they can be more affordable, ranging from $100 to $250 per mount, their quality can vary. Some aftermarket mounts are excellent, but others may not offer the same vibration dampening or longevity as OEM parts. It's crucial to research reputable aftermarket brands.

How is an engine mount replaced?

Replacing engine mounts is a precise and potentially hazardous procedure that requires specialized equipment and expertise.

  1. Engine Support: The engine must be securely supported before the mounts are removed. This is typically done using an engine support brace that rests across the engine bay, preventing the engine from falling when its mounts are disconnected. Never support the engine with a jack or jack stand alone, as this can easily damage the oil pan or other components.
  2. Component Removal: Any obstructing components, such as intake hoses, wiring harnesses, or even parts of the subframe, are carefully removed to gain access to the engine mounts.
  3. Mount Removal and Inspection: The old engine mount is unbolted and removed. It's often given a final inspection to confirm its failure.
  4. New Mount Installation: The new engine mount (OEM or aftermarket) is installed.
  5. Alignment and Tightening: The technician ensures the new mount is correctly aligned and all fasteners are tightened to the manufacturer's specifications. Proper torque is crucial for longevity and performance.
  6. Reassembly and Testing: All removed components are reinstalled. The vehicle is then started, and the technician will test drive it to confirm that the vibrations and noises have been resolved and the customer's complaint has been addressed.

Cost-Saving Strategies

While the Audi Q8 engine mount replacement cost can be substantial, there are ways to manage the expense.

Getting Multiple Quotes

Always obtain quotes from at least two or three reputable repair shops, including both dealerships and independent specialists. Compare not only the total price but also what is included (e.g., OEM vs. aftermarket parts, warranty on labor).

Best Timing for Repairs

While not always a major factor, consider if your vehicle is due for other maintenance. Bundling repairs can sometimes be more cost-effective than performing them separately, as labor costs for accessing certain areas might be shared.

Warranty Considerations

Check if your Audi Q8 is still under its manufacturer warranty or an extended warranty. Many powertrain components, including engine mounts, are covered for a certain period or mileage. If so, the repair might be covered at no cost to you.

FAQ Section

How much does Audi Q8 Engine Mount Replacement Cost?

The average cost for an Audi Q8 engine mount replacement is between $575 and $658, with labor estimated between $317 and $400, and parts around $258. This can vary based on location, parts used, and the specific shop.

Can I drive with this problem?

While you might be able to drive with worn engine mounts, it's not advisable. Increased vibrations can reduce driving comfort, and in severe cases, a completely failed mount could lead to engine movement that damages other vehicle components. It's best to address the issue promptly.

How long does Audi Q8 Engine Mount Replacement take?

The replacement of one or two engine mounts typically takes between 2 to 4 hours of labor. However, the total time at the shop will also include diagnostic checks, administrative processes, and potential delays, so plan for at least half a day.

What causes this issue?

Engine mounts typically fail due to normal wear and tear from constant exposure to engine heat, vibration, and the stresses of driving. Age, mileage, and the quality of the original mounts all contribute to their eventual degradation.
